Output 1604626c001e28cc24bd107e74ec68f37abd6512e7a0e795f6c320c610832a70:0

value
21370
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c332df8835e3de8380bdd743d64dbb4f643d57ccd609da2beca4a9ee19af7025
address
bc1pcvedlzp4u00g8q9a6apavndmfajr647v6cya52lv5j57uxd0wqjs369l7y
transaction
1604626c001e28cc24bd107e74ec68f37abd6512e7a0e795f6c320c610832a70
spent
true